claver
cla·ver C0393500 (klā′vər) Scots intr.v. cla·vered, cla·ver·ing, cla·vers To gossip or talk idly.n. Gossip; idle talk. [Perhaps of Celtic origin.]claver (ˈkleɪvə) vb (intr) to talk idly; gossipn (often plural) idle talk; gossip[C13: of uncertain origin]claver Past participle: clavered Gerund: clavering
